DigitalOcean Holdings, Inc. (NASDAQ:DOCN) Shares Sold by Wolf Hill Capital Management LP

Wolf Hill Capital Management LP lowered its position in shares of DigitalOcean Holdings, Inc. (NASDAQ:DOCNFree Report) by 57.8% in the second quarter, according to its most recent 13F filing with the SEC. The firm owned 880,635 shares of the company’s stock after selling 1,208,349 shares during the quarter. DigitalOcean comprises approximately 3.0% of Wolf Hill Capital Management LP’s holdings, making the stock its 12th largest holding. Wolf Hill Capital Management LP owned approximately 0.97% of DigitalOcean worth $30,602,000 at the end of the most recent quarter.

DigitalOcean Stock Up 2.4 %

Shares of NASDAQ DOCN opened at $43.26 on Friday. The stock has a market capitalization of $3.94 billion, a P/E ratio of 81.57, a PEG ratio of 3.15 and a beta of 1.83. The stock’s 50 day moving average price is $35.19 and its two-hundred day moving average price is $35.85. DigitalOcean Holdings, Inc. has a 52-week low of $19.39 and a 52-week high of $43.88.

DigitalOcean (NASDAQ:DOCNGet Free Report) last announced its quarterly earnings data on Thursday, August 8th. The company reported $0.48 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, topping the consensus estimate of $0.39 by $0.09. DigitalOcean had a negative return on equity of 31.71% and a net margin of 9.30%. The firm had revenue of $192.00 million for the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$188.63 million. During the same period last year, the business posted $0.11 earnings per share. The firm’s revenue for the quarter was up 13.1% on a year-over-year basis. On average, analysts anticipate that DigitalOcean Holdings, Inc. will post 0.86 EPS for the current year.

DigitalOcean Profile

(Free Report)

DigitalOcean Holdings, Inc, through its subsidiaries, operates a cloud computing platform in North America, Europe, Asia, and internationally. The company's platform provides on-demand infrastructure and platform tools for developers, start-ups, and small and growing digital businesses. It also offers infrastructure-as-a-service (IaaS) solutions comprising compute and storage services, as well as networking projects, including Cloud Firewalls software, Managed Load Balancers software, and Virtual Private Cloud (VPC).
